Animal rights activists have long sought out international organizations that address animal welfare on a global scale. The World Society for the Protection of Animals (WSPA) is an international nonprofit organization that works to promote animal welfare, advocate for animal rights, end animal cruelty, and encourage the responsible use of animals. The WSPA operates in more than 50 countries, focusing on humane animal farming practices, ending the exploitation of wild animals, and providing veterinary care for animals in need. The Royal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als (RSPCA) is another international organization that works to improve animal welfare. The RSPCA has 25 branches across the world and focuses on providing animal education, awarding grants for animal research, and stopping the illegal animal trade. The Humane Society International (HSI) is a global nonprofit organization that works to protect animals from cruelty and abuse. HSI advocates for humane animal farming practices and works to end animal testing in the cosmetics industry. The International Fund for Animal Welfare (IFAW) is a global organization that works to end animal suffering and promote coexistence between people and animals. IFAW’s initiatives are aimed at ending illegal hunting, protecting endangered species, and preventing the exploitation of wild animals. These and other international organizations are working to protect animal rights and end animal cruelty globally.
